Anticipated Holiday Periods
- Mid-Year Break: Generally around June/July, offering several weeks of vacation.
- Term Breaks: Shorter breaks throughout the school year, typically a week or two.
- End-of-Year Break: A longer break, usually starting in November or December and extending into the new year.
- Public Holidays: Integrated into the holiday schedule, offering additional days off.
Keep an eye on official announcements for the exact dates to make your plans.

Outdoor Adventures
Brunei is a nature lover's paradise. Take your kids on a jungle trek in the Ulu Temburong National Park. It's an incredible experience and it lets the kids see some amazing biodiversity. If you're looking for something a bit closer to home, check out the various parks and recreational areas. The Tasek Lama Recreational Park in Bandar Seri Begawan is a fantastic spot for a picnic, a leisurely walk, or playing on the playground. Make sure you pack snacks and drinks, and don’t forget the sunscreen! Another great idea is a visit to the Jerudong Park Playground. It's got something for all ages, with rides, games, and entertainment. Perfect for a day of thrills and excitement. If you're up for a bit of adventure, consider a camping trip. There are several spots around Brunei that are perfect for setting up a tent and spending a night under the stars. Just make sure you get the necessary permits and plan for safety.
Beaches are also a great option. Brunei has some beautiful beaches perfect for swimming, building sandcastles, and simply relaxing. Check out Muara Beach or Serasa Beach. Remember to bring beach toys, towels, and plenty of water to stay hydrated. Water sports are also a blast if you’re up for it! Think kayaking, paddleboarding, or even a boat trip to explore the coastline. This is a great way to get some exercise and enjoy the beautiful scenery. Indoor Fun
On those rainy days, or when you just want a break from the sun, indoor activities are a lifesaver. Consider a visit to a local museum, like the Brunei Museum or the Malay Technology Museum. They offer a great opportunity to learn about the history and culture of Brunei in an engaging way. Movie theaters are always a hit.
